The Classic Messy Bun: Your Everyday Savior

Let’s start with the one you probably already know — the classic messy bun. It’s the OG style that looks effortless but never boring.

How to Do It:

  1. Flip your head upside down and gather your hair into a high ponytail.
  2. Twist the ponytail loosely, wrap it around the base, and secure it with a hair tie or bobby pins.
  3. Tug out a few strands to add volume and that perfectly imperfect finish.

Pro Tips:

  • Texture spray or dry shampoo is your best friend. It adds grip and volume.
  • If your bun looks too “neat,” gently pull it apart with your fingers to loosen it up.

This bun is ideal for running errands, working from home, or casual hangouts. It screams “I woke up like this” — but in the best way possible.


Low Messy Bun: The Elegant Upgrade

When you need something more polished but still relaxed, the low messy bun is your go-to.

How to Style It:

  1. Gather your hair at the nape of your neck.
  2. Twist it into a loose bun and secure it.
  3. Pull out a few face-framing pieces for that soft, romantic look.

This style works wonders for date nights, office days, or even formal events. Pair it with pearl earrings or a sleek blazer — and boom, effortless sophistication.


Messy Bun with Braids: The Creative Twist

If you’re bored of the usual bun, why not add a braid or two? The braided messy bun combines texture and artistry in the prettiest way.

Steps to Nail It:

  1. Start with a small braid on one or both sides of your head.
  2. Gather the rest of your hair into a bun, mixing the braid into it.
  3. Loosen the braid slightly for a relaxed vibe.

This version looks stunning for music festivals, weddings, or just when you want that “boho-chic” energy.

Bonus Tip: Add a few hair accessories like tiny clips or floral pins to take it from casual to glam instantly.

High Messy Bun: The Instagram Favorite

You’ve seen it — that perfectly messy top knot influencers love to flaunt. It’s flirty, confident, and makes your cheekbones pop.

How to Get It Right:

  1. Flip your head and gather your hair high on your crown.
  2. Twist it loosely and secure it with a tie.
  3. Gently pull pieces out for that undone look.

This bun is perfect when you want your outfit (or makeup) to shine because it draws attention upward.

Pro Tip: Use a scrunchie or silk tie for a softer, trendy vibe.


Double Messy Buns: The Playful Pick

Why stop at one bun when you can have two? The double messy bun (aka space buns) is the definition of fun.

How to Rock It:

  1. Part your hair down the middle.
  2. Create two high ponytails, one on each side.
  3. Twist each into a messy bun and secure.

You can make them tight for a bold look or loose for a softer style. It’s youthful, quirky, and super trendy — ideal for concerts or casual weekends.


Messy Bun for Short Hair: Yes, It’s Possible!

Think you need long hair for a messy bun? Nope. You can totally rock one with short or medium-length hair too.

Here’s How:

  • Gather as much hair as you can into a low or mid bun.
  • Use bobby pins to secure stray pieces.
  • Leave a few strands out for that relaxed texture.

You can even fake a fuller bun by teasing the ponytail before twisting it.


Messy Bun for Curly Hair: Embrace the Volume

Curly hair + messy buns = match made in heaven.

Instead of fighting frizz, let your natural curls add that dreamy, voluminous touch.

Styling Tips:

  • Use a leave-in conditioner or curl cream to define your curls before styling.
  • Gather your hair loosely to avoid breaking the curl pattern.
  • Pull out a few curls near your face for that soft, carefree finish.

This bun looks great for casual outings, gym days, or even dressy evenings with minimal effort.

Common Mistakes to Avoid (So Your Bun Looks Stylish, Not Sloppy)

Messy doesn’t mean careless. Here are a few things to watch out for:

  • Don’t use too much product — it can weigh your hair down.
  • Avoid super-tight hair ties; they can cause breakage.
  • Skip over-brushing — a little texture makes the bun better.
  • Don’t forget volume! A flat bun can look dull, so fluff it up a bit.
